The California Consumer Privacy Act (CCPA) is a state statute intended to enhance privacy rights and consumer protection for residents of California, United States. Sales of users’ Personal Data & how Customers can opt-out of the selling of their Data.

As per the CCPA stature, a “sale” of personal data means that data is exchanged directly for money or similar valuable consideration. Customer Rights under CCPA

Apprise Marketing Services is obliged to protect your data privacy. We hold ourselves accountable & demonstrate compliance with the latest international data protection regulations.

The following is a list of customer rights under CCPA:

  • 1) The Right to Access or Disclosure of the Personal Data.
  • 2) The Right to Erasure or Delete Personal Data.
  • 3) The Right to Data Portability.
  • 4) Right to opt-in for Personal data processing & restriction of Data Processing i.e.
    Right to Opt-Out.
  • 5) Right to being prohibited from discrimination having exercised their right pursuant to CCPA such as the right to opt-out of gathering or monetization of their personal data.
